Choosing the Right Pop-Up Camping Tent
Speed & Ease of Setup
One of the biggest draws of pop-up tents is their quick setup. However, “instant” isn’t always equal. Some tents genuinely pop up in under a minute, utilizing pre-assembled poles and a simple throw-and-release system. Others might require a little more maneuvering, even if still faster than traditional tents. Consider your camping style: If you frequently arrive at campsites after dark, or prioritize minimizing setup time, a truly instant model is crucial. Conversely, if you don’t mind a few extra minutes and value other features, a slightly more involved setup might be acceptable.
Size and Capacity
Pop-up tents range dramatically in size, from backpacking-friendly 2-person models to spacious options for large families. Tent capacity ratings are often optimistic. A “4-person” tent might comfortably fit two adults and gear, or a queen-size air mattress with limited space. Think about how you sleep – will you be using air mattresses, sleeping bags, or cots? Account for gear storage inside the tent. Checking interior dimensions (length, width, and peak height) is key to ensure everyone fits comfortably and you can stand up if desired.
Waterproofing & Weather Resistance
Waterproofing is critical, even if you don’t anticipate heavy rain. Look for a tent with a waterproof rating (measured in millimeters – mm). A rating of 2000mm or higher is generally considered good for moderate rain. Pay attention to where the waterproofing is applied: the tent fabric itself (polyester or nylon are common), the rainfly, and the floor. Sealed seams are also essential to prevent leaks. Beyond waterproofing, consider wind resistance. Features like sturdy poles, guylines (ropes that anchor the tent), and a robust stake system contribute to stability in windy conditions.
Ventilation & Airflow
Good ventilation is often overlooked, but it’s vital for comfort. It prevents condensation buildup inside the tent (which can make you wet and cold) and keeps the interior cooler in warm weather. Look for tents with multiple mesh windows and vents. Some models feature a mesh ceiling for enhanced airflow. D-shaped doors and vents at the floor level promote convection, drawing cool air in and pushing warm air out.
Portability & Packed Size
While pop-up tents are convenient, some models can be bulky and heavy when packed. Consider the packed size and weight, especially if you’ll be backpacking or have limited storage space in your vehicle. Lighter materials and more compact folding mechanisms can significantly reduce the burden. Look for tents with included carry bags, and consider whether the bag has backpack straps for easier transport.
